SAN FRANCISCO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sep 10, 2025--
Planet Labs PBC (NYSE: PL), a leading provider of daily data and insights about Earth, today announced Scott Reese has been elected to Planet’s board of directors by stockholder written consent, to be effective later this year. Mr. Reese is the Chief Executive Officer of the Electrification Software business at GE Vernova (NYSE: GEV), a $150 billion plus market capitalization purpose-built global energy company.

Mr. Reese has an impressive career in the software industry with extensive experience in product development, strategy, and design. Before joining GE Vernova, he served as Executive Vice President of Product Development & Manufacturing Solutions at Autodesk (NASDAQ: ADSK), where he joined in 2003 with the acquisition of VIA Development Corporation and went on to hold various leadership roles. He served on the board of directors at Model N, Inc. (NYSE: MODN) from 2019-2024. He holds a Bachelor of Science in computer information systems and a Master of Business Administration from Indiana Wesleyan University.
In accordance with applicable laws, Mr. Reese’s election will become effective on the 40th day after the related Notice of Internet Availability of Information Statement is first sent to Planet's stockholders, which Planet expects to occur in early November 2025.
About Planet Labs PBC
Planet is a leading provider of global, daily satellite imagery and geospatial solutions. Planet is driven by a mission to image the world every day, and make change visible, accessible and actionable. Founded in 2010 by three NASA scientists, Planet designs, builds, and operates the largest Earth observation fleet of imaging satellites. Planet provides mission-critical data, advanced insights, and software solutions to customers comprising the world’s leading agriculture, forestry, intelligence, education and finance companies and government agencies, enabling users to simply and effectively derive unique value from satellite imagery.
